Open the bonnet, remove 4 torx screws that hold the grille in.

Then use the screwdriver to pry up 4 hingies behind the grille (poke it through the honeycombes on the bottom).

Take out the grille, then twist the VW logo (not sure if its left or right) and pull out!

KennyPOLO_Gti wrote:So a just have to twist it off then??? :?

There is a small tab behind the badge at the top, you can get to this by lifting the bonnet and slipping your hand down the back of the grill. Give it a squeeze while turning the badge anti-clockwise. Turn the badge about a quarter turn and should then just pull out.

Once the badge is out you can then carefully split the chrome VW part from the part that holds it into the grill by gently pushing the tabs at the rear of the badge, but be careful not to break any.
